That was part of my pitch, that maybe the DC Universe J'onn felt a little bit in between alien and human, in a way that wasn't a positive for the character, that wasn't a positive for readers. Where he is a little too alien to be relatable to, and maybe a little too human to really be awed by the alienness of him. And so that's part of why I separated the two characters and made John Jones a human being that we can relate to, and make the Martian this really strange alien consciousness that that has strange ideas that maybe that are not so relatable to us, and that's okay, because they're not really relatable to John either, and John's our way in and through John, hopefully we'll come to see whether those ideas are palatable or not. -- Deniz Camp

Still working through that big stack of zines from Jimmy Dunson and Rebel Hearts Press, and we're down to the last thing: a paper back anthology of essays entitled Building Power While The Lights Are Out: Disasters, Mutual Aid, and Dual Power. It's really making my brain buzz with ideas! I'm only midway through, but so far my favorites are "Mutual Aid and Anti-Racist Organizing in Rural Appalachia" by Rural Organizing and Resilience, "Love My People: Following in the Footprints of the Panthers" by Suncere Ali Shakur, and "Survival Programs: Then And Now" by Malik Rahim (an old guy in his seventies who was part of the Black Panthers in the '70s). Like the other stuff from Rebel Hearts, it looks to be a paper-only release.

I just want to quote a few paragraphs from Shakur here, because... how could I NOT love this book? He cut his teeth on mutual aid in the wake of Hurricane Katrina, where black men were getting murdered as looters by vigilantes, cops, and others.
